1. Declutter The Space

Before you start exploring kitchen remodeling ideas, it is imperative to declutter the kitchen space. Make an inventory of the appliances, cookware, and utensils present. You might be surprised to find plenty of broken utensils, appliances that you have never used, and cookware with missing parts. Now short-list the items you don’t use anymore and can be used by someone else. Consider donating these items, gifting them to a friend, or putting them up in a yard sale. Once you get rid of the clutter, you will see an evident change in the kitchen space. 

2. Open Kitchen Space

If you have the budget, consider taking some wall partitions down to give your kitchen a fresh and modern look. Exploring open kitchen concepts will help you better utilize this kitchen renovation process. You will be giving your kitchen a new layout and allowing further room for expansion if necessary. With an open kitchen, it becomes easier to interact with friends and family while you cook for them. However, since it will directly affect the structure, it is wise to consult with professionals offering home remodeling services in your area. They guide you on structural safety, layout flow, and the smartest way to open up your space without creating future problems.

6. Make Use of Space

Identify odd places and unused spaces in cabinets and make it a functional kitchen. Storing the right type of kitchen utensils in the right place is also necessary. Let’s say you have filer drawers in your kitchen, using them to store spices and smaller utensils is better than storing tableware. Adding bottom cabinets is another consideration if you want to store other kitchen and cooking-related items. 

7. Swapping Appliances

Several appliances can be replaced with their modern models which can save kitchen space. A food processor can replace the need of keeping a juicer, blender, and grinder as separate appliances. Replacing older models with their new versions not only saves up kitchen space but is also cost-effective as they use way less energy than the previous models. Checking the energy star rating of the appliances you buy can help in determining their energy efficiency.
